Check Engine Light Flashing

A flashing check engine light in your 2017 Toyota Yaris typically indicates a severe misfire, catalytic converter risk, or other condition that can cause immediate engine damage. 2017 Toyota Yaris Check Engine Light Codes

Common diagnostic trouble codes for the 2017 Toyota Yaris include P0420 (catalyst efficiency), P0300 (random/multiple misfires), P0171/P0174 (system too lean), and oxygen sensor faults. Left unaddressed, these issues escalate costs: a neglected catalytic converter can be costly to replace, running well into the thousands, while a failed oxygen sensor or misfire fixed promptly is often a few hundred dollars.
